French ditches, also known as French drains, are essential for managing water drainage and preventing water damage to properties.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Length of the Drain: The longer the drain, the higher the cost due to additional materials and labor.
- Depth and Width: Deeper and wider drains require more excavation, which increases costs.
- Soil Type: Rocky or clay-heavy soil can complicate excavation, leading to higher expenses.
- Materials Used: Higher-quality materials, such as gravel and perforated pipes, can raise the overall cost.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Nicholasville, KY, can vary, impacting the total installation cost.
- Additional Features: Adding features like sump pumps or catch basins can increase the cost.

Task | Average Cost (Nicholasville, KY) |
---|---|
Basic French Drain Installation (per linear foot) | $25 - $40 |
Excavation Costs (per cubic yard) | $50 - $75 |
Gravel (per ton) | $30 - $45 |
Perforated Pipe (per linear foot) | $1.50 - $3.00 |
Sump Pump Installation | $800 - $1,500 |
Catch Basin Installation | $200 - $400 |
